In the case of a truck accident, some people may be confused about who they can pursue for damages. Depending on the circumstances of your case, we may be able to seek compensation from multiple liable parties.
If the road on which your accident occurred was not kept safe, we may be able to pursue compensation from the relevant government agency or organization who should have monitored and acted to fix the street. For instance, if we discover that your accident could have been prevented if a pothole in the road was filled, we may be able to pursue this avenue of compensation.
If the trucking company encouraged the truck driver to ignore safety regulations, like the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A)’s Hours of Service Regulations, they could be held liable. The company might have told the driver to overload the trailer with cargo, making the vehicle heavier and harder to brake suddenly in the event of danger. The company may have implemented unreasonable scheduling demands that encouraged the driver to operate a truck under extreme fatigue or tiredness. If we find that any of these elements were present in your accident, we can work to assign negligence to the trucker’s employer.
If a defective or improperly installed truck component contributed or caused your accident, then the party whose responsibility it was to catch and prevent such a malfunction could be liable for your injuries. We can explore all recorded inspections and any existing documents pertaining to the initial assembly of the truck.
The motorist behind the wheel of the truck is, to some extent, likely responsible for causing your accident. When you work with The Kryder Law Group, LLC, we can analyze the evidence at the accident scene to determine how your collision occurred. For instance, our Bolingbrook truck crash attorneys may be able to review the trucker’s logbook to determine when the truck was last serviced, how much the vehicle was supposedly carrying, and when the driver last rested. Should we find any discrepancies or clear violations, we may be able to hold the individual trucker accountable.

735 ILCS 5/13-202 imposes a statute of limitations of two years from the date of an accident to move forward with a civil action. You must act within this period or risk forfeiting your right to pursuing compensation. In some situations, you may be able to toll this timeframe. Speak with a lawyer to determine how long you may have to act.
